Superconducting strings in the two-Higgs doublet model
arXiv:2410.03300 · doi:10.1016/j.physletb.2025.139714
Abstract
We present superconducting vortex solutions in the two-Higgs doublet model which has a gauged Higgs-family symmetry. We write down an ansatz for the solution and study its basic properties, for the case of both global and gauged symmetries. We demonstrate its prima-facie stability using 3D numerical simulations of a global version of the theory, observing the flow of current along the string. We discuss how generic such a phenomena might be and the possible consequences if such a model is found in nature.
